Output 75097e5c75f0eccb7166e0c6c18c50828955e5e7c9e93578d6b7f19186cdb30d:0

value
42700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9775529106a7ade3547449cf2d76a227f8512f20 OP_EQUAL
address
MMhzp7FSP4xArxPWDEEg9YQYppDrDMq5bb
transaction
75097e5c75f0eccb7166e0c6c18c50828955e5e7c9e93578d6b7f19186cdb30d
spent
true